Stewardship over service
We Act Like Your Business Is Our Own
A vendor delivers the scope. A steward asks whether the scope is right in the first place. We’re stewards.
That means decisions get made based on what’s truly best for your business, even when it costs us short-term revenue. If the package you signed up for isn’t the right one anymore, we say so. If a service we offer isn’t going to move the needle for you, we’ll tell you not to buy it.
What this looks like in practice: - We turn down work we don’t think will deliver. - We recommend cutting services we sold you, when they stop working. - We make hiring recommendations that reduce your spend with us.

Transparency by default
If We Did It, You Can See It
No magic box. No mystery dashboards. No “trust us, it’s working.”
You see the work. You see the numbers. You own the accounts and the data. Every dollar of ad spend, every keyword we target, every change we made to your website — visible. Always.
What this looks like in practice: - You have direct admin access to every account we run for you. - Reporting shows raw data, not just a vanity score. - We tell you what didn’t work, not just what did.
Teach, don’t just deliver
Every Engagement Leaves You More Capable Than You Started
We’re not building a moat of dependency. We’re building a more capable contractor.
The contractor who finishes a year with us should understand their marketing better than they did when they started — even if that means they could eventually run more of it in-house. Some clients do. We’re fine with that. The ones who stay, stay because they want to, not because we’ve made it impossible to leave.

Honest before easy
We Tell You What You Need to Hear, Not What You Want to Hear
If your growth target is unrealistic, we’ll name it. If your messaging is confusing the wrong customer, we’ll show you. If a piece of work we delivered isn’t working, we’ll bring it up before you do.
Hard conversations are the job. Avoiding them is how trust breaks down.
What this looks like in practice: - We push back on goals we don’t believe in. - We flag problems early, even if they’re our fault. - We don’t apologize for disagreeing with you, when disagreement is the right call.

Frequently Asked Questions
Where did these values come from?
They came from 30 years of watching what works and what doesn’t in this industry. Each one is connected to a specific kind of failure we’ve seen contractors put up with from agencies — and a specific kind of behavior we decided wasn’t acceptable here.
Do you actually turn down work because of these values?
Yes. We turn down clients who aren’t the right fit, decline to sell services we don’t think will deliver, and end engagements where we can’t get the contractor’s buy-in to do the work right. We’d rather have fewer clients we can do excellent work for than more clients we’d embarrass ourselves with.
What does “transparency by default” actually mean for me as a client?
You have admin-level access to every account we manage for you. You can see raw data, not curated reports. You can export anything we’ve built. If you leave us tomorrow, you walk out with all of it.
How does the “teach, don’t deliver” value affect engagements?
Training is part of how we work, not a separate product. As we run your marketing, we’re also showing your team how it’s run. The goal is for your team to understand the work well enough to either keep running pieces of it in-house, or hold us accountable to a higher standard.
Is the faith value something you bring up with clients?
It’s an internal standard, not a client-facing pitch. We live it. If you ask about it, we’ll talk about it. If you don’t, you’ll just notice that we keep our word.
What if I disagree with your push-back on a decision?
It’s your business. You get the final call. We’ll say our piece, give you the reasoning, and back you up once you’ve decided. But we’d rather risk the disagreement than nod through something we think is the wrong move.
How do these values show up in pricing and contracts?
We don’t lock you in for years. We don’t sneak fees in. We use plain-English contracts. We don’t hold your accounts hostage when an engagement ends.
What do you do when you fall short of these values?
We name it, fix it, and don’t pretend it didn’t happen. If you’re a client and you feel we’ve fallen short, we want to hear it directly. The fastest fix is a call.
